Sunday, March 6, 1955 Earthquake
The earthquake hit Philippines on Sunday, March 6, 1955 at 10:55 UTC with a magnitude of 6.1. The closest known location in the current dataset is Bayawan (Philippines - PH), about 55.3 km away. The epicenter is located at longitude 122.347 and latitude 9.574.
